1. A method for performing quality analysis for multidimensional printing, the method comprising:
setting up a multidimensional printer, wherein the multidimensional printer comprises a printing head, a printing surface, an axis system and a scale, wherein the scale is arranged to measure weight applied on the printing surface;
defining, in a control unit, a set of parameters for performing quality analysis for multidimensional printing, wherein the control unit is operatively coupled to the multidimensional printer; and
operating the control unit, based on the set of parameters, for:
controlling the printing head to extrude a printing material, to produce a printing object on the printing surface,
obtaining, from a flow meter, an actual density of the printing material, at any of:
a real-time or after a pre-defined interval, while the printing object is being produced;
obtaining, from the scale, the weight of the printing object;
calculating, based on the weight and a flow rate, an obtained density of the printing object;
comparing the obtained density of the printing object with the actual density of the printing material;
wherein the obtained density of the printing object differs from the actual density of the printing material, changing at least one of: a pre-defined density, a pre-defined volume, a pre-defined flow speed, a pre-defined cross-sectional area;
obtaining, from the scale, a weight applied on the printing surface due to the extruding, and storing the weight applied to the printing surface in a memory associated with the control unit,
comparing the weight with a reference weight of the printing object, and
controlling the printing head to stop extrusion of the printing material when the weight is equal to or exceeds the reference weight.
